Common misconception. Social Security isn’t going away. What goes insolvent is the trust fund, which is basically the surplus reserve built up over decades. The program itself keeps running because it’s funded by ongoing payroll taxes. The problem is without that cushion, benefits have to be cut to match what’s coming in, around 20-23% reduction. Congress could fix it tomorrow if they wanted to. They just don’t.
